The UAMS College of Pharmacy requires 60 semester hours of prerequisite coursework from a US-accredited institution to apply for the PharmD program. Applicants may apply prior to completing prerequisites, but they should be complete by the end of the spring semester prior to fall entry. Pharmacy-Based ...Oct 20, 2023 · Admission to the School of Pharmacy requires completion of a baccalaureate degree; completion of the specified prerequisite college courses, with a grade of C or better; and a minimum 3.0 (A = 4.0) grade point average, both in the prerequisite courses and cumulative grade point average. Complete or be in the process of completing a minimum of two years of pre-pharmacy course requirements (60 semester hours) at an acceptable accredited collegiate institution. The student must earn a grade of C (2.0) or better in each prerequisite course. Our preferred minimum pre-pharmacy grade point average (PPGPA) required for application consideration is 3.000. Grades below “C” are not accepted. if you received a grade of “C” the first time you completed organic chemistry, then repeated the course with a grade of “A”, we disregard the “C” and calculate PPGPA using the “A”.Many pre-pharmacy students obtain a Bachelor of Science (B.S) or Bachelor of Arts (B.A) degree while completing the requirements for admission to …About Pre-Pharmacy.
